Jennison Associates LLC decreased its holdings in Trinity Industries, Inc. (NYSE:TRN - Free Report) by 21.8%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 3,691,884 shares of the transportation company's stock after selling 1,028,222 shares during the period. Jennison Associates LLC owned about 4.51% of Trinity Industries worth $98,167,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Trinity Industries Profile

(Free Report)

Trinity Industries, Inc provides rail transportation products and services under the TrinityRail name in North America. It operates in two segments, Railcar Leasing and Management Services Group, and Rail Products Group. The Railcar Leasing and Management Services Group segment leases freight and tank railcars; originates and manages railcar leases for third-party investors; and provides fleet maintenance and management services.
